Chhota Dumarhir is a Rural village located in Boarijor, Godda, Jharkhand.
The total population of Chhota Dumarhir is 232.
Chhota Dumarhir village comprises 60 households.
The literacy rate in Chhota Dumarhir is 42.5%. Among the literate population of 82, there are 49 literate males and 33 literate females.
In Chhota Dumarhir, there are 118 males and 114 females, with a sex ratio of 966 females per 1000 males.
There are 39 children (16.8% of population), comprising 22 boys and 17 girls.
The total number of workers in Chhota Dumarhir is 121, with 115 main workers and 6 marginal workers.
In Chhota Dumarhir, there are 0 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(0 males, 0 females) and 201 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(99 males, 102 females).
Chhota Dumarhir is located in Jharkhand state, Godda district, and falls under Boarijor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 356165 and LGD code is 356165.
